#e61026 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#e61026 is composed of 90.2% red, 6.3% green and 14.9%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 93% magenta, 83.5% yellow and 9.8% black. It has a hue angle of 353.8 degrees, a saturation of 87% and a lightness of 48.2%. #e61026 color hex could be obtained by blending #ff204c with #cd0000. Closest websafe color is: #ff0033.

#e61026 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#e61026 has RGB values of R:230, G:16, B:38 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.93, Y:0.83, K:0.1. Its decimal value is 15077414.
